 Market Overview

The Nicotinamide Riboside Hydrogen Malate Market is gaining strong momentum as global consumers increasingly prioritize preventive healthcare, healthy aging, and performance optimization. Nicotinamide riboside (NR), a precursor to NAD+ (nicotinamide adenine dinucleotide), has become widely recognized for its potential to support cellular energy metabolism and longevity. When combined with hydrogen malate, the compound offers improved stability and enhanced bioavailability, making it attractive for dietary supplement manufacturers and pharmaceutical innovators alike.

The global Nicotinamide Riboside Hydrogen Malate (NR-HM) market size is predicted to grow from US$ 24.8 million in 2025 to US$ 32.3 million in 2031; it is expected to grow at a CAGR of 4.5% from 2025 to 2031.

Over the past few years, demand for NAD+ boosters has expanded beyond niche biohacking communities into mainstream wellness markets. Consumers are more informed than ever, actively seeking clinically backed ingredients that support mitochondrial function, metabolic health, and cognitive performance. This shift has positioned nicotinamide riboside hydrogen malate as a premium ingredient in capsules, tablets, powders, and functional beverages.

The market is witnessing steady growth across nutraceutical, pharmaceutical, and research sectors. With expanding clinical research and product launches, manufacturers are investing in advanced synthesis technologies to ensure purity, consistency, and scalability. As the global aging population increases and lifestyle-related disorders remain prevalent, the market outlook remains highly promising.

Market Dynamics

Several key factors are driving the growth of the Nicotinamide Riboside Hydrogen Malate Market. The rising awareness of cellular health and anti-aging science is one of the primary growth engines. Scientific studies linking NAD+ depletion to aging and metabolic decline have fueled consumer interest in supplementation strategies that restore NAD+ levels.

Additionally, the expansion of the global nutraceutical industry is creating favorable conditions for ingredient manufacturers. Consumers are shifting from reactive treatment models to proactive wellness routines, leading to increased spending on high-quality supplements. The clean-label movement and demand for clinically supported formulations further enhance the appeal of nicotinamide riboside hydrogen malate.

Regulatory scrutiny around novel dietary ingredients varies by region, potentially affecting product approvals and marketing claims. High production costs associated with advanced synthesis and purification processes can also limit entry for smaller manufacturers. Furthermore, competition from alternative NAD+ precursors such as nicotinamide mononucleotide (NMN) adds competitive pressure.

Opportunities lie in expanding clinical research, personalized nutrition solutions, and partnerships between biotech firms and supplement brands. As more scientific evidence becomes available, confidence among healthcare professionals and consumers is expected to increase, supporting long-term market expansion.

Regional Analysis

North America currently holds a significant share of the Nicotinamide Riboside Hydrogen Malate Market, driven by strong consumer awareness, high disposable income, and a well-established dietary supplement industry. The United States, in particular, is a major hub for NAD+ research and product innovation.

Europe follows closely, supported by growing interest in longevity science and preventive healthcare. Regulatory frameworks in the region emphasize product safety and quality, encouraging manufacturers to maintain rigorous compliance standards.

The Asia-Pacific region is emerging as a high-growth market due to expanding middle-class populations, increasing health consciousness, and rapid development of the nutraceutical sector. Countries such as China, Japan, South Korea, and India are witnessing rising demand for advanced wellness supplements.

Meanwhile, Latin America and the Middle East & Africa are gradually adopting premium nutraceutical ingredients, supported by urbanization and growing awareness of healthy aging trends. Regional expansion strategies and localized marketing efforts will play a vital role in capturing these emerging opportunities.
